"Mary Had a Little Lamb" is originally an American nursery rhyme song. It was first written as a poem by Sarah Josepha Hale in 1830.

According to Wikipedia, "In the Korean language, the melody of "Mary Had a Little Lamb" corresponds to a different nursery rhyme known as "Airplane" (비행기). The lyrics describe the flight of an airplane and were written by the Korean poet Yoon Seok-joong, who has been known since 1924 for his poems and nursery rhymes."

There's also a version in Japanese circa 1927 called "Mary-san no Hitsuji"
by Sankuzo Takada. It may still be under copyright.
